We discussed about expressive deviation from “regular timing” with respect to Gamelan music often, and came to the view that - as Gamelan music is ensemble music - an adequate description must include an idea of how multiple performers influence each other, of how effective timing is a result of negotiation between multiple agents. Unfortunately that “multi-agency” perspective made things very complicated from the outset so that we never actually reached a stage, in which timing was actually generated interactively.
